System:
1. Accessibility and Ease:
Among major known reasons for the widespread selling point of online poker is its accessibility. In comparison to brick-and-mortar casinos, online poker platforms provide players the freedom to try out at any time, anywhere. With a well balanced net connection, poker enthusiasts will enjoy a common online game without leaving their particular houses, getting rid of the need for travel. Furthermore, online poker web sites supply an array of choices, including different variants of poker, tournaments, and different share levels, providing to players of all skill amounts.
